I actually came up with an idea that gives me a rough idea. I registered a domain name (sunsetspotlight.com), which is the name of our printed newsletter. Then I forwarded it to a bit.ly URL shortener. bit.ly let's you count clicks. Then the bit.ly link forwards to our lds.org newsletter site. The user is required to log into lds.org but is then taken directly to the newsletter. bit.ly lets me check daily to see how many people are going thru that link, giving me a rough idea of usage.
